weblogic在centos上如何调优数据库连接

在CentOS上部署和调优WebLogic以连接数据库,可以通过以下步骤进行:

1. 配置数据库连接池

  • 创建数据源:在WebLogic控制台中,创建JDBC数据源并配置数据库连接信息,包括数据库URL、用户名、密码和驱动程序。
  • 调整连接池参数:在连接池配置中,可以设置初始容量、最大容量、容量增长值、重试创建的频率、登录延迟和非活动连接超时等。

2. 调整TCP连接数

  • 修改TCP连接数:通过调整WebLogic下的TCP连接数,增加"Accept Backlog"选项的值,可以避免因连接数满而导致的连接错误。

3. 监控和日志分析

  • 启用连接泄漏检测:在WebLogic控制台的Connection Pools Tab和Diagnostics中,启用Connection Leak Profiling,查看相关日志以诊断连接泄漏问题。
  • 分析日志:检查WebLogic服务器的日志文件,关注AdminServer.out、server_name.out和server_name.log等日志文件,查找错误信息。

4. 其他调优建议

  • 关闭无用服务:关闭不必要的服务以释放系统资源。
  • 调整内核参数:通过修改/etc/sysctl.conf文件调整内核参数,如vm.swappinessnet.ipv4.tcp_fin_timeout等,以提高系统性能。
  • 使用高性能的Web服务器:在CentOS上,Nginx和Apache是比较常用的Web服务器。Nginx是一个高性能的HTTP和反向代理服务器,它使用异步非阻塞的事件驱动架构,可以轻松处理大流量的请求。

在进行任何重大更改之前,建议先在测试环境中验证其效果,并确保系统的稳定性和安全性不受影响。此外,调优是一个持续的过程,需要根据系统的实际运行情况定期进行评估和调整

Both comments and pings are currently closed.

Comments are closed.

Powered by KingAbc | 粤ICP备16106647号-2 | Loading Time‌ 0.247